The Prevalence of Intimate Partner Violence and Association with Depression in University Students: Results of a Cross-sectional Study

Arif Musa 1, Alfonso J Valdez 2, Jose L Aguilar 3, Kasim Pendi 4, Kate B Wolitzky-Taylor 5, Danny Lee 6, Joshua Lee 6, David Safani 7
PMCID: PMC8092032  NIHMSID: NIHMS1636368  PMID: 33141781

Abstract

The purpose of this cross-sectional study was to determine the prevalence of IPV among university students, investigate potential predictors of IPV in this population, and study the link between IPV and depression. The survey included socio-demographic, relationship quality, and depression related questions. From 498 respondents, prevalence of IPV was 4.8%, depression was 30.9%, and suicidal ideation was 20.3%. After adjusting for co-variates and confounders, relationship satisfaction (OR=0.201, 95% CI: 0.101 to 0.401, p<0.001) and jealousy (OR=0.270, 95% CI: 0.094 to 0.776, p=0.015) were significant predictors of IPV. Relationship satisfaction predicted depressive disorders (OR=0.504, 95% CI: 0.365 to 0.698, p<0.001). IPV trended towards predicting presence of a depressive disorder (OR=0.436, 95% CI: 0.170 to 1.113, p=0.083). Relationship satisfaction and jealousy predicted IPV. Although IPV did not predict depression, poor relationship satisfaction increased odds of depression, implicating the influence of relationship satisfaction on both IPV and depression.

Introduction

Intimate partner violence (IPV) is of considerable concern in the university setting. However, previous reports to document rates of physical abuse among intimate partners have been limited by small sample sizes and conflicting results. Furthermore, several studies lack data from male students or restricted data collection to undergraduate students. For example, Lewis and Fremouw described intimate partner abuse in one of three college couples (Lewis and Fremouw, 2001). By comparison, Kaukinen, Gover, & Hartman reported that 27% of female college students experienced some form of dating violence (Kaukinen et al., 2012). Studying rates of IPV among males and females, and among undergraduate and graduate students, is necessary to lead grounded efforts to prevent and address IPV in the university setting.

More than physical injury, IPV can also cause deterioration in mental health and even lead to the development of major psychopathology (Sugg et al., 2015). In fact, Lagdon, Armour, & Stringer reported a significant association between IPV and both anxiety and depression in a systematic review of the literature (Lagdon et al., 2014). Although, the relationship between IPV and poor mental health outcomes has been previously documented, research in college students has produced conflicting findings, been limited by small sample sizes, or lacked data from male students (Sugg et al., 2015; Kamimura et al., 2016; Kamimura et al., 2016; Garner and Sheridan, 2017; Christopher and Kisler, 2012). College students have high rates of anxiety and depressive disorders as well as other mental disorders but often do not seek treatment (Pendi et al., 2015; Eisenberg et al., 2007; Zivin et al., 2009). Therefore, investigating the potential link between IPV and mental disorders among college/university students is paramount in order to better understand the etiological factors associated with psychopathology and spur efforts to screen for these problems on-campus.

In order to address these issues, the study was designed with the following objectives: (1) to establish the prevalence of IPV, depression and suicidal ideation in university students, (2) identify potential predictors of IPV, and (3) study the link between IPV and depression in this population.

Method

Institutional Review Board approval was obtained prior to conducting this study. Strengthening the Reporting of Observational Studies in Epidemiology (STROBE) guidelines were used in the reporting of this study (Vandenbroucke et al., 2007).

The survey tool consisted of a socio-demographic and relationship quality questionnaires, Relationship Assessment Scale (RAS), Hurt-Insult-Threaten-Scream (HITS) Domestic Violence Screening Tool, and Patient Health Questionnaire-9 (PHQ-9). Socio-demographic items included questions about sex, age, sexual/affectional orientation, institution, student type, student class, religious affiliation, ethnicity and/or race, parental household income, relationship type, relationship status, and substance use. Relationship quality items included questions about jealousy, flirting, cohabitation, sexual activity, and sexually explicit electronic messaging.

The Relationship Assessment Scale (RAS) was included as a global measure of relationship quality after previously demonstrating test-retest reliability and validity in the university setting (Renshaw et al., 2010). HITS Domestic Violence Screening Tool, a highly-studied questionnaire to measure IPV, was selected as a concise tool to measure intimate partner violence (Shakil et al., 2005; Rabin et al., 2009). The scale was modified to include additional items to capture past instances of IPV up to one year, such that individuals who were not in a relationship at the time of participation could report previous experiences of IPV. A total score ≥10 was considered positive for experience of IPV (Sherin et al., 1998). Finally, the PHQ-9 scales have each demonstrated reliability and validity in numerous settings and are widely accepted as screening tools of depression severity (Manea et al., 2015). The PHQ-9 has been previously used to identify depression in undergraduate and graduate students (Eisenberg et al., 2007). A cutoff PHQ-9 score ≥10 was used to detect moderate to severe depression (Manea et al., 2015). Suicidal thoughts were identified by a score ≥1 on question 9 of the PHQ-9. The rationale for incorporating these standardized scales into one questionnaire was based in part on the recommendation of the campus sexual assault prevention and resource services team that was consulted for this study.

The survey was administered online to students at a large, public university in California from September 30th, 2016 to January 30th, 2017. Recruitment began on June 1st 2016. Participants were offered an opportunity to be entered into a lottery for an e-gift card. Only full-time graduate or undergraduate students aged 18 years or older were eligible to participate. Participants constituted a voluntary sample recruited indirectly via emails sent by university faculty listed in the directory (n=1997). Data were not collected on whether faculty chose to send electronic communications. Respondents were given an option for participating in a lottery for an e-gift card.

The survey was made available online via secure and encrypted online tool, Research Electronic Data Capture (REDCap) (Harris et al., 2009). To calculate a suitable sample size to assess IPV as a risk factor and predictor for depression, a power analysis was performed with α set at 0.05 and power of 80%. Based on a conservative estimate of 20% for moderate to severe depressive disorders in those who experienced IPV, a sample size of n=342 was required to detect odds ratio (OR) of 2.0 predicted by IPV as modeled by logistic regression.

Responses with missing data were excluded. Potential respondents were given the opportunity to end the survey at any time with the understanding that their partial data would be excluded from analyses. Categorical socio-demographic and relationship quality items with more than two response categories were dichotomized prior to further analysis and sensitivity analyses were performed for all variables dichotomized this way. Age (18–20 years vs 21 or older), sexual orientation (heterosexual vs non-heterosexual), class (lowerclassmen including freshman and sophomore students vs upperclassmen including junior, senior and students in their 5th year or later), religion (affiliated vs non-affiliated), ethnicity (Asian, Caucasian), race (Hispanic vs non-Hispanic), parental income ($34,000 and below vs $35,000 and above), alcohol (use vs no use), tobacco (use vs no use), marijuana (use vs no use), other drugs (use vs no use), relationship type (exclusive vs non-exclusive or single), and relationship status (committed vs non-committed). Group comparisons were made using Student’s t-test for continuous variables and chi-square for categorical variables. Variables that achieved statistical significance according to t-test were also incorporated as potential confounders into a binary logistic regression model. Logistic regression models were used to identify potential predictors.

Analyses were carried out using Microsoft® Excel Version 15.11.2 for Mac (Microsoft, Redmond, WA, USA) and IBM® SPSS® Version 22.0 for Mac (IBM, Chicago, IL, USA).

Results

Responses were collected from 687 participants. The university enrollment during the time period of data collection was 33,467. There were 687 entries with 498 responses incorporated into analyses, constituting 2.1% and 1.5% of total enrollment, respectively. Of those, 498 (72.5%) had complete responses and were incorporated into further analyses. Due to the recruitment strategy used for this study, the total number of students reached could not be determined, and a response rate could not be calculated. Descriptive information regarding socio-demographic and relationship quality data are provided in Table 1 and Table 2, respectively.

None of the socio-demographic variables were significantly associated with IPV. Among relationship measures, only relationship satisfaction (OR=0.201, 95% CI: 0.101 to 0.401, p<0.001) and jealousy (OR=0.270, 95% CI: 0.094 to 0.776, p=0.015) were significant predictors of IPV. Relationship satisfaction was the sole significant predictor of depression (OR=0.504, 95% CI: 0.365 to 0.698, p<0.001).

Discussion

This study found the prevalence of IPV among university students to be 5%, a low percentage when compared to previous studies. This discrepancy may be attributable to differences in study settings, eras, and demographic characteristics. For example, rates of physical violence have been reported to be lower in a four-year university compared to a community college setting (Daley and Noland, 2001). Also, although Rouse, Breen, & Howell found that physical abuse was experienced by 11% of college students, that study was conducted nearly three decades ago (Rouse et al., 1998). More recently, Kaukinen, Gover, & Hartman described victimization rates as high as 27%, but among female college students only (Kaukinen et al., 2012). By comparison, the sample in this study consisted of both male and female students enrolled full-time at a four-year university. Further, the study institution has an active office that provides campus-wide support, education, and training to students to prevent or respond to acts of violence.

Intimate partner violence is likely underreported in this sample. There is a discrepancy between reporting IPV and prevalence data from large-scale studies, which suggest that a large percentage of cases of domestic violence go underreported (Garcia, 2004). In fact, victims often underreport domestic abuse due to privacy concerns, fear of violence from the offender, and even a desire to protect the offender (Felson et al., 2002). In addition, because the HITS contains items addressing primarily physical and verbal abuse, the prevalence of sexual violence, a component of IPV that may involve stalking, dating violence, or forced sex, was not captured by this study. Furthermore, the students may have had concerns regarding privacy as the survey link was forwarded to them by their professors. This is less likely in light of the high rates of self-reported depressive disorders and suicidal ideation. In addition, an incentive lottery was offered to increase response rate but may have degraded data quality because respondents that receive incentive may be more likely to skip items, rush, or answer items inaccurately (Laguilles et al., 2011; Barge and Gehlbach, 2011). Kaukinen, Gover, & Hartman suggested that since many students engage in their first romantic relationships during college, they may not perceive some forms of violence as abnormal and/or may not have developed the appropriate communication skills to resolve disputes encountered in their romantic relationships (Kaukinen et al., 2012; Kaukinen, 2014). As a result, students may not have thought to report certain violent behaviors in this survey.

Another major finding of this study was that nearly one-third of students (31%) endorsed moderate-to-severe depression and one-fifth (20%) reported suicidal ideation during several days over the previous two weeks. These results indicate an increasing burden of depression compared to previous studies such as that of Eisenberg, Gollust, Golberstein, & Hefner, which found the prevalence of depression to be 13.8% in undergraduate students and 11.3% in graduate students (Eisenberg et al., 2007). It is likely that the reasons for this increase are multi-factorial but may be in-part due to factors not measured in the study, such as increased use of internet and television, sedentary lifestyle, and lack of sleep, which appear to be pertinent to the current student population (Carli et al., 2014). It is also notable that the increasing prevalence of depression in this population mirrors global trends (Pendi et al., 2016; Lépine and Briley, 2011). These findings underscore the need for effective depression and suicide screening efforts in universities at the undergraduate and graduate levels.

In this study, severity of IPV did not differ significantly between males and females. Although previous studies found that female students experienced more severe forms of abuse, a recent study found that women experienced more minor injuries and men experienced more severe injuries (Rouse et al., 1988; Amanor-Boadu et al., 2011; Cercone, Beach, & Arias, 2005). Moreover, it has been suggested that relationship violence is often perpetrated mutually (Kaukinen et al., 2012). Neither age nor sexual orientation was a predictor of IPV according to this study. However, Porter & Williams described a significant association between gay, lesbian, and bisexual students with physical and sexual abuse in intimate relationships (Porter and Williams, 2011). The reason for this discrepancy may be due to differences in the sample. Porter & Williams studied college students from a private university in the northeastern United States while this study was a survey of undergraduate and graduate students from a large, public university in the southwest (Porter and Williams, 2011).

This study was the first to evaluate potential differences in IPV rates according to student type (undergraduate or graduate) and class (lowerclassmen and upperclassmen), finding that neither was a significant predictor of intimate partner abuse. Similarly, religious affiliation was not noted to affect experience of IPV in this sample of university students. Although it has been suggested that spirituality may reduce risk of victimization, there remains a paucity of research identifying protective factors such as religiosity in terms of preventing domestic violence (Kaukinen, 2014). Ethnicity or race was also not associated with increased experience of physical violence in intimate relationships, a finding supported in-part by the previous study by Porter & Williams, which did not identify a significant link between racial or ethnic minorities and physical abuse (Porter and Williams, 2011). Parental household income approximating the poverty level or below was the final socio-demographic predictor not significantly associated with IPV among university students.

Neither relationship type nor relationship status was a significant predictor for experience of IPV according to this study. While Kaukinen, Gover, & Hartman similarly reported few differences in physical violence between casual and exclusive relationships among female college students, this study supported those findings among a heterogeneous sample of both male and female students (Kaukinen et al., 2012). The majority of undergraduate and graduate students in the study sample reported alcohol consumption and nearly 1/3 endorsed marijuana use, but few indicated use of tobacco or other drugs. Alcohol, in particular, is a classic predictor of relationship violence, but there are no longitudinal studies that describe the effect of drug use on victimization in college students (Kaukinen, 2014). As a result, this study suggests that neither use of alcohol, marijuana, nor other drugs was a predictor of IPV in university students.

Notably, relationship satisfaction was linked to lower odds of IPV in this sample. Whether addressing these relationship attributes through counseling may help to prevent IPV constitutes one area for further study. Interestingly, jealousy was linked to lower odds of IPV. While previous reports have linked jealousy to IPV (Hilberman and Munson, 1977; Rounsaville, 1978), the findings of the current study suggest that the inverse is true in the university setting and that jealousy may be a protective factor. Why relationship jealousy negatively predicted IPV in this sample remains an avenue for future research.

This study did not find a significant correlation between IPV and depression in university students. Although the relationship between IPV and poor mental health outcomes has been previously documented, previous studies in the college setting have indicated conflicting findings (Sugg, 2015; Kamimura et al., 2016; Kamimura et al., 2016; Garner and Sheridan, 2017; Christopher and Kisler, 2012). For example, Kamimura, Nourian, Assasnik, & Franchek-Roa found that Iranian college students that experienced IPV reported greater depression severity (Kamimura et al., 2016). However, IPV was not significantly associated with depression in Japanese, Singaporean, South Korean, and Taiwanese college students [6]. But American college women that suffered from physical abuse from an intimate partner, experienced symptoms of both anxiety and depression (Christopher and Kisler, 2012). Also, among female college students with pre-existing disorders or disabilities, victimization by an intimate partner was linked to exacerbation of depression (Bonomi et al., 2017). In younger female students, depressive symptoms have been associated with an increased risk of moderate to severe IPV, suggesting that addressing depressive symptoms in adolescent women may help limit their experience of IPV (Lehrer et al., 2006). It has also been suggested that cultural factors may mediate the relationship between IPV and depression, although the present study did not find the related factors of ethnicity or race to significantly affect rates of IPV or depression (White and Satyen, 2015).

Relationship satisfaction predicted lower odds of depression in this sample in line with previous studies that have documented significant links between relationship satisfaction and depression (Whitton and Whisman, 2010; Whitton and Kuryluk, 2012; Whitton and Kuryluk, 2014). Moreover, Stavianopoulos noted that couples therapy to enhance relationship satisfaction produced a statistically significant reduction in symptoms of depression (Stavrianopoulos, 2015). These findings suggest utility in asking university students about their relationships in the context of mental health screening. A post-hoc analysis to determine the effects of relationship quality measures on suicidal ideation did not demonstrate similar predictive value.

The findings of this study are moderated by certain limitations in the design and methodology. First, this study and the majority of studies performed to measure domestic violence have utilized a cross-sectional study design, but more longitudinal studies are necessary to accurately address the questions posed. Second, although this study obtained a large sample size, convenience sampling may lead to a response bias toward students in a relationship at the time of participation or experiencing hardship in their relationships. Given that participants were asked to recall cases of abuse over a 12-month period, there is also potential for recall bias. Third, although the HITS domestic violence screening tool has been noted for its reliability and validity, it was not designed specifically to measure violence among university students and did not include items to address sexual abuse or financial abuse behaviors. Finally, given that the study sample may not completely reflect the total student enrollment (e.g. nearly 78% of respondents were female), the generalizability of these findings are limited.

Conclusions

This study found the prevalence IPV to be 5% among university students, although this is likely to be an underestimation. Prevalence of moderate to severe depressive disorders and suicidal thoughts was 30% and 20%, respectively. Both relationship satisfaction and jealousy were significant predictors of IPV, while only relationship satisfaction was a predictor of a depressive disorder. Further research on interventions for IPV, depressive disorders, and suicidal ideation in the university setting are needed.
